Teshikaga Ramen is a beloved spot in Sapporo's Ramen Alley, known for its flavorful miso-based broths and perfectly cooked noodles. The restaurant offers a cozy, lively atmosphere with counter seating that lets diners watch the kitchen in action. It's a must-visit for ramen enthusiasts looking for an authentic Hokkaido experience.

Signature Dish
Miso Ramen with Butter Corn
A rich, hearty miso broth topped with tender chashu pork, sweet corn, and a pat of butter for a creamy finish.
Vibe/Setting
Teshikaga Ramen offers a warm and lively atmosphere with counter seating that provides a close-up view of the kitchen. The space is cozy and bustling, perfect for a casual meal with friends or solo dining.
